In February 2025, the Board approved a $900m share buyback programme which completed on 29 December 2025.
In February 2024, the Board approved a $800m share buyback programme which completed on 27 December 2024.
In February 2023, the Board approved a $750m share buyback programme which completed on 29 December 2023.

a.Shares were repurchased and subsequently cancelled.
b.Includes transaction costs. In 2025, $15m of taxes previously provided for in respect of the 2024 and 2023 buyback programmes were reversed,
following legislative changes.
c.In 2023, $38m related to the completion of the 2022 programme and $752m related to the 2023 programme.
The Board reviewed the Parent Company Financial Statements to confirm availability of sufficient distributable reserves
prior to approving shareholder returns.
For each of the share buyback programmes undertaken, authority was given to the Company at the respective AGM prior
to commencement of the buyback.
In February 2026, the Board approved a further $950m share buyback programme. A resolution to renew the authority
to repurchase shares will be put to shareholders at the AGM on 7 May 2026.
The Company no longer has an authorised share capital.
